Castello di Querceto Chianti Classico 2010

Review
The nose is a lovely blend of ripe red fruits, with floral violet notes and a darker spicier side reminiscent of a higher quality Chianti.
The palate is a medium bodied affiar, with soft rounded flavours of red and purple fruits, plum, some cherry and a slight hint of raspberry. The tannins are very fine and delicate, the overall sensation is a soft rounded wine but the acidity is relatively high, giving the wine a freshness of texture throughout.

Rating
2010: 89 Points - Bruce Sanderson, Wine Spectator: "Smooth and opulent for Chianti, exhibiting black currant, violet and licorice flavors. Bright and balanced, with a long finish of fruit and mineral. Best from 2014 through 2021. "

2010: 88 Points - Antonio Galloni, Robert Parker's Wine Advocate: "The 2010 Chianti Classico emerges from the glass with big, generous fruit supported by the firm tannins of the vintage. Black cherries, plums, smoke and licorice wrap around the plush finish. This is a fairly large-scaled style for the year. There is more than enough depth in the fruit to make me think the 2010 will drink nicely for a number of years. Anticipated maturity: 2013-2020. "
